#e1c4dd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e1c4dd is composed of 88.2% red, 76.9%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.9% magenta, 1.8%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 308.3 degrees, a saturation of 32.6% and a lightness of 82.5%. #e1c4dd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c389bb.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#e1c4dd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e1c4dd has RGB values of R:225, G:196,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.02,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14795997.
